What Are Online Test Drives?
Online test drives incorporate innovation with the car-buying process, using virtual experiences that mimic a physical test drive. Through various platforms, car dealerships offer prospective purchasers with interactive tools and immersive technologies that allow them to explore vehicles from the convenience of their homes. A few of the most common functions of online test drives consist of:

360-Degree Vehicle Views: This feature lets users practically inspect the vehicle's exterior and interior, appreciating its design and functions.

VR (Virtual Reality) Experiences: Some dealerships are utilizing VR innovation to create a more sensible feel of driving the car, making it possible to browse different terrains and environments.

Video Walkarounds: Sales agents can provide live or pre-recorded video tours of the automobile, covering all essential functions and specs.

Augmented Reality (AR): AR applications enable users to predict the vehicle into their environment, enabling them to imagine how it would look in their driveway or garage.
